一百例的Logo
  • 首页
  • 系统开发
    • bada
    • BlackBerry
    • Symbian
    • JavaME
    • WindowsPhone
    • webOS
    • MeeGo
    • HarmonyOS
    • IOS
    • Android
  • 前端开发
    • cocos2D
    • Unity3D
    • 快应用
    • 小程序
    • HTML5
    • Javascript
    • Webpack
    • Typescript
    • Swift
    • Actionscript
  • 后端开发
    • Kotlin
    • Docker
    • Perl
    • PHP
    • Delphi
    • Netty
    • VB
    • Python
    • C
    • C#
  • 登录 注册
首页
后端开发
C
C语言实现Huffman编码详解

C语言实现Huffman编码详解

21 次浏览 2024-04-27 0 条评论
cpp
cpp
数据压缩 Huffman编码 C语言 算法实现 代码详解
实例介绍 下载 评论 相关推荐

这份Huffman编码的C语言实现包含详细的注释,对于有需要的人来说非常有价值。代码清晰易懂,能够帮助学习者深入理解Huffman编码的原理和实现过程。

cpp 文件大小:3.79KB

相关推荐

Huffman编码

Huffman编码的C实现,输入句子,打印各个字母的编码。
23 2024-08-17

Huffman编解码C语言实现

哈夫曼编码的 C 语言实现,逻辑清晰、思路直接,挺适合拿来练练数据结构的基本功。思路上就是先统计字符频率,再搞一棵哈夫曼树,一通编码解码下来,压缩效果还挺。整体过程不复杂,但关键点不少,比如如何用最小...
0 2025-06-15

算数游程编码及C语言实现详解

详细介绍了算数游程编码的原理和C语言实现方法,提供了全面的代码示例。代码未经验证,读者需注意验证代码的正确性。
25 2024-07-15

C++实现Huffman编码

用C++编写了Huffman编码,并添加了注释以提高可读性。编码结果如下:第1个数:00000,第2个数:000010,第3个数:0110,第4个数:000011,第5个数:01110,第6个数:00...
23 2024-04-21

Huffman编码-数据结构c语言PPT

Huffman编码利用字符集C作为叶子结点,频度集W作为结点权值构造树。左分支表示“0”,右分支表示“1”。从根结点到每叶子结点路径上的“0”或“1”构成编码,称为Huffman编码。每字符为叶子结点...
21 2024-04-23

基于C/C++的Huffman编码实现与应用

介绍了利用C/C++语言实现Huffman编码算法的方法,并重点阐述了其在ASCII字符压缩中的应用。该程序能够对包含ASCII字符集的文件进行有效压缩,为文本数据的存储和传输提供了高效的解决方案。
21 2024-07-01

赫夫曼编码的C语言实现

这是一份C语言源代码,用于构建和编码赫夫曼树。通过模拟赫夫曼树的构造并进行编码,帮助学者理解数据结构中的赫夫曼树算法。代码简洁易懂,附有详细注释和报告书说明。
21 2024-04-21

huffman树文件压缩c语言

用优先队列构造huffman树,然后压缩编码,由8个字符串的huffman编码转换成unsinged char,保存到压缩文件,从而实现压缩.要对文件进行解压缩,要将编码的huffman树保存到压缩文...
21 2024-07-30

C语言实现简单编码保密系统

将介绍一个编码保密系统的C语言实现示例。该程序通过简单的编码方法对文本进行保密处理,从而使得传输内容无法被轻易识别。 程序结构 输入文本信息 对每个字符进行编码处理 输出加密后的信息 C语言代码示例 ...
22 2024-11-06

Huffman 编码 MFC 可视化实现

利用 MFC 框架,开发了一款可视化 Huffman 编码程序,能够将用户输入的文本进行 Huffman 编码,并以图形化的方式展示编码过程和结果。
25 2024-04-30

BCH3121编码解码C语言实现

BCH3121 的编码解码 C 语言实现,适合做通信协议里那点事儿的时候用。这个源码挺实用,结构也清晰,关键是能学到不少纠错编码的门道。适合你刚好在搞传输可靠性优化,或者想深入了解 BCH 怎么个计算...
0 2025-06-05

Quake3自适应Huffman编码实现

Quake3 引擎里的自适应 Huffman 编码,说实话,设计得还挺巧的。和普通的 Huffman 不同,它在数据传输过程中会动态调整编码树,适应变化的内容分布,压缩率更高。这种方式对实时游戏数据传...
0 2025-05-30

c语言实现vector

C语言实现vector源码
22 2024-09-02

C语言实例教程详解

介绍了C语言实例教程,涵盖了基础语法和常见编程示例,帮助读者深入理解C语言编程。通过详细的示例和解释,读者可以掌握C语言编程的基本技能,适合初学者和希望提升编程能力的人士。
21 2024-07-13

用C语言实现哈夫曼编码

哈夫曼编码这东西,多人听说过,但你知道怎么用 C 语言实现它吗?其实不难。哈夫曼编码是一种无损数据压缩的算法,常用在文本压缩、图像编码等领域。你输入的字符和它们的频率会帮你生成一个最优编码方式。嗯,这...
0 2025-06-15

Huffman编码方法-数据结构c语言版严蔚敏PPT

Huffman编码方法以字符集C作为叶子结点,次数或频度集W作为结点的权值来构造Huffman树。规定Huffman树中左分支代表“0”,右分支代表“1” 。从根结点到每个叶子结点所经历的路径分支上的...
22 2024-09-02

G.729语音编码标准及C语言实现

使用共轭结构代数编码激励线性预测对语音进行8Kbit/s编码,这是ITU网站的标准文档,常用于IP电话系统,具有高音质。提供了基于C语言的软件实现源码。
27 2024-05-26

Huffman编码数据压缩算法

字符频率驱动的压缩算法,Huffman 编码是个经典的老伙计了,压文本特管用。核心就是构造一棵Huffman 树,常见字符用短码,稀有字符用长码,压完效果往往挺惊喜。你要是真想看源码实现,像用C++或...
0 2025-05-28

c语言实例详解与介绍

简单的C语言代码详解,学习了解,基础,比较基础,可以简单的了解一下
19 2024-08-14

des_c语言实现

c语言实现的des算法,自己写的代码,注释详细,流程清晰亲测可用,纯C写的,还有一份是QT写的代码。
19 2024-08-09

评论区

暂无评论,快来说点什么吧~
上传赚取积分

最新上传

VB大学社团管理平台

06-18

IOComp 4.0.4SP2Delphi组件库

06-18

mxshop-goods-srv Go+Python电商微服务初始化脚本

06-18

ActionScript高级可视化组件开发

06-18

Delphi图片Base64互转与水印处理

06-18

Node.js 10.15.0Linux ARMv6l

06-18

Blog Vue.js博客开发框架

06-18

ActionScript 3异常和错误处理教程

06-18

CMake 2.8.3开发手册详解

06-18

隐藏拷贝文件支持界面隐藏与快捷键控制

06-18

下载排行

1

开发一个随机字符变换效果的jQuery插件完整教程

562次下载
2

Physically-Based Rendering (PBR) 模型 Unity 导入包

481次下载
3

MeshBaker 3.1 性能优化插件

427次下载
4

Unity Log DLL使用

410次下载
5

New Touch9.0.rar更新版

360次下载
6

Liquid Volume 5.5.0

359次下载
7

Unity未引用资源一键清理工具自动删除与备份功能解析

357次下载
8

Amplify Shader Editor 1.7.5提升Unity视觉创作效率的高级插件

350次下载
9

HTML5面试题解析

344次下载
10

Unity SRDebugger - Console Tools On-Device 1.12.1.

343次下载

一百例 © 2024-2025 湘ICP备2021015693号